4Dapa 10mg Tablet may be unsafe to use during pregnancy. Although there are limited studies in humans, animal studies have shown harmful effects on the developing baby.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ing it to you. Please consult your doctor. | - Breast feeding : CON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
4Dapa 10mg Tablet is probably unsafe to use during breastfeeding. Limited human data suggests that the drug may pass into the breastmilk and harm the baby. | - Driving : CAUTION
Your ability to drive may be affected if your blood sugar is too low or too high. Do not drive if these symptoms occur. | - Kidney : UNSAFE
4Dapa 10mg Tablet is probably unsafe to use in patients with kidney disease and should be avoided. Please consult your doctor. | - Liver : SAFE IF PRESCRIBED
4Dapa 10mg Tablet is safe to use in patients with liver disease. No dose adjustment of 4Dapa 10mg Tablet is recommended.
